Utilisation en ligne de commande

Une fois l’outil installé, il est appelable en ligne de commande : gpf-generate-archive.

Fonctionnement général

Ce script est chargé de copier sur le stockage final tous les fichiers livrés au sein des livraisons en entrée. Cette copie doit permettre de créer une nouvelle donnée stockée ARCHIVE diffusable ou d’en mettre à jour une déjà existante. Voir le ticket originel : https://jira.worldline.com/browse/IGNGPF-553.

Commandes et options

GPF Generate Archive 1.6.0 - Ce script est chargé de copier sur le stockage final tous les fichiers livrés au sein des livraisons en entrée. Cette copie doit permettre de créer une nouvelle donnée stockée ARCHIVE diffusable ou d’en mettre à jour une déjà existante. Voir le ticket originel : https://jira.worldline.com/browse/IGNGPF-553

gpf-generate-archive [-h] [-v] [--version] [-w GPF_WORK_DIR]
                     [-c GPF_INPUT_CONFIGURATION_FILENAME] [--s3-url GPF_S3_URL]
                     [--s3-key GPF_S3_KEY] [--s3-secret-key GPF_S3_SECRETKEY]
                     [--s3-region GPF_S3_REGION]

gpf-generate-archive options

  • -h, --help - show this help message and exit

  • -v, --verbose - Verbosity level: None = WARNING, -v = INFO, -vv = DEBUG (default: 1)

  • --version - show program’s version number and exit

  • -w GPF_WORK_DIR, --workdir GPF_WORK_DIR, --work-dir-path GPF_WORK_DIR - Input working directory. Must exist. (default: None)

  • -c GPF_INPUT_CONFIGURATION_FILENAME, --input-configuration-filename GPF_INPUT_CONFIGURATION_FILENAME - Name (not the path) of the input configuration file. (default: parameters.json)

  • --s3-url GPF_S3_URL - Url du storage S3 (default: http://localhost:9000)

  • --s3-key GPF_S3_KEY - Utilisateur du stockage S3 (default: admin)

  • --s3-secret-key GPF_S3_SECRETKEY - Password du stockage S3 (default: minioadmin)

  • --s3-region GPF_S3_REGION - Region du stockage S3 (default: eu-west-3)

Ce script est chargé de copier sur le stockage final tous les fichiers livrés au sein des livraisons en entrée. Cette copie doit permettre de créer une nouvelle donnée stockée ARCHIVE diffusable ou d'en mettre à jour une déjà existante. Voir le ticket originel : https://jira.worldline.com/browse/IGNGPF-553.

Développé par Loïc Bartoletti, Jean-Marie Kerloch, Julien Moura
Documentation : https://geoplateforme.pages.gpf-tech.ign.fr/traitements-vecteurs/gpf_generate_archive/

Variables d’environnement

Génériques

Nom de la variable

Argument CLI correspondant

Valeur par défaut

GPF_INPUT_CONFIGURATION_FILENAME

--input-configuration-filename

parameters.json

GPF_WORK_DIR

--work-dir-path

GPF_S3_URL

--s3-url

``

GPF_S3_KEY

--s3-key

admin

GPF_S3_SECRETKEY

--s3-secret-key

minioadmin

GPF_S3_REGION

--s3-region

eu-west-3